Book Description
‘Q: I make quantities of elderflower cordial but am trying to find a recipe for ginger cordial. I have searched many recipe books but none mentions a ginger one. Can you help?’ ‘Q: I have a large family and we are all partial to Turkish delight. Perhaps it’s just me but the shop bought stuff doesn’t seem to taste like it used to. Can you provide a recipe so that we could try making it ourselves?’ ‘Q: Since I spend much of my time riding or working in the garden, I get through a lot of hand cream. Is it possible to make it myself?’ ‘Q: Can bats and moles swim?’ These are just a few of the queries covered in this charming and invaluable title, filled with questions from readers of The Field, answered by their most knowledgeable columnists for more than 150 years. Filled with quirky illustrations by Kerry Lemon, this meticulously edited book provides an intriguing selection of useful information and solutions on various topics (household, food, drink, gardening, animals, sporting, fishing, and more), which will become a little gem in every household.
